Garden digging services involve the careful excavation and preparation of soil in residential outdoor spaces. This work typically includes tasks such as removing turf, loosening compacted earth, creating planting beds, or installing new features like pathways or retaining walls. Skilled service providers use the appropriate tools and techniques to ensure the soil is properly prepared for planting or construction, helping to create a solid foundation for a variety of garden projects. This service is often needed when homeowners are planning to redesign their landscape, plant new trees or shrubs, or install features that require a stable and well-prepared base.
Many common problems can be addressed through professional garden digging. For instance, overgrown or compacted soil can hinder plant growth and lead to poor garden health. Additionally, uneven terrain or areas prone to water pooling may require excavation to improve drainage and level the ground. Garden digging can also resolve issues related to existing structures that need to be removed or replaced, or when preparing a new area for landscaping. Local contractors can help homeowners overcome these challenges by providing precise and efficient excavation work tailored to the specific needs of the property.

The overview below groups typical Garden Digging proj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Madison, WI.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or garden digging projects, such as planting beds or removing small sections of soil, often range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on size and complexity.
Medium-Scale Projects - Larger tasks like creating new garden areas or installing edging usually cost between $600-$2,000. These projects are common for homeowners looking to update or expand their landscape features.
Large or Complex Jobs - Extensive garden renovations or significant soil excavation can reach $2,000-$5,000 or more. Fewer projects push into this high tier, typically involving detailed planning and substantial labor.
Full Garden Replacement - Complete overhaul or major redesigns of garden landscapes can exceed $5,000, depending on scope and site conditions. Local contractors can provide estimates based on specific project requirements and site size.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
